在电子商务网站中,订单号是每个订单的唯一标识符,对于网站的运营和管理至关重要。手动生成订单号不仅效率低下,而且容易出错。因此,很多开发者会选择使用自动生成订单号的功能。本文将手把手教你如何在jsp页面中实现订单号的自动生成。

jsp自动生成订单号实例手把手教你实现订单号的自动生成  第1张

一、准备环境

1. 开发工具:Eclipse、MyEclipse、IntelliJ IDEA等任选其一。

2. 数据库:MySQL、Oracle、SQL Server等任选其一。

3. JSP环境:Tomcat 7及以上版本。

二、数据库设计

我们需要在数据库中创建一个用于存储订单信息的表。以下是一个简单的订单表结构:

字段名数据类型说明
idINT主键,自增
order_numberVARCHAR(50)订单号
user_idINT用户ID
order_timeDATETIME下单时间
......其他订单信息

三、生成订单号

订单号的生成通常遵循一定的规则,例如:

1. 年月日(YYYYMMDD)

2. 顺序号(例如:001、002、003...)

3. 随机数或校验码

以下是一个简单的订单号生成示例:

```java

public String generateOrderNumber() {

SimpleDateFormat sdf = new SimpleDateFormat("